Gene Expression is a fundamental process of any living cell. In eukaryotic cells, the genetic information is transcribed into mRNA by RNA polymerase II.  Already cotranscriptionally the mRNA is processed (capped, spliced, and polyadenylated).  In addition, the mRNA is packaged into a mature mRNP. Since nucleoplasm and cytoplasm are separated by the nuclear envelope, the mRNP needs to be exported through the nuclear pore complexes (NPCs) into the cytoplasm. Here, the information encoded in the mRNA is translated into a polypeptide chain by the ribosomes.
These events do not occur consecutively, but are tightly interconnected. This coupling guarantees an efficient and accurate expression of the genetic information and thus provides a quality control mechanism for this fundamental cellular process.
